The Reliability of Attitude/Motivation Test Battery (AMTB) in Iran as an EFL Context

To determine whether integrative motivation exists in EFL contexts like ESL ones, the present study examined the generalizability of the Gardner's socio-educational model to Iranian context. To see the link between motivation as examined or discussed in other subject fields than L2 and motivation as explained in previous L2 researches, and lastly to see the obvious implications that such previous L2 studies have for language pedagogy Gardner proposed his model of second-foreign language learning in 2001, maintaining that the model is capable of organizing the main concepts seem to be included in L2 learning motivation. Gardner himself used the AMTB in four EFL contexts, e.g., Croatia, Poland, Spain, and Romania and obtained similar results as the Canadian ESL context. In this study the reliability and the correlation coefficients between the subscales of the AMTB and the total scores were analyzed.
